Iron Mountain Logo

Iron Mountain

Senior Executive - Customer Support

Posted 3 Days Ago
Be an Early Applicant
In-Office
2 Locations
Senior level
In-Office
2 Locations
Senior level
The Customer Success Manager enhances customer retention and drives growth by managing relationships, supporting sales, and resolving escalated issues effectively.
The summary above was generated by AI

At Iron Mountain we know that work, when done well, makes a positive impact for our customers, our employees, and our planet. That’s why we need smart, committed people to join us. Whether you’re looking to start your career or make a change, talk to us and see how you can elevate the power of your work at Iron Mountain.

We provide expert, sustainable solutions in records and information management, digital transformation services, data centers, asset lifecycle management, and fine art storage, handling, and logistics. We proudly partner every day with our 225,000 customers around the world to preserve their invaluable artifacts, extract more from their inventory, and protect their data privacy in innovative and socially responsible ways. 

Are you curious about being part of our growth stor​y while evolving your skills in a culture that will welcome your unique contributions? If so, let's start the conversation.

Summary:

The Customer Success Manager (CSM) plays a critical role within Iron Mountain’s National and Vertical Sales team for North America. Supporting all service lines, the CSM partners with Directors and Business Development Executives (BDEs) to deliver outstanding customer service, drive retention, and identify growth opportunities within strategic and vertical accounts.

Key Responsibilities:

Relationship Management:

  • Develop and maintain strong relationships with key customer stakeholders to understand their business objectives and align Iron Mountain solutions accordingly.
     

  • Collaborate with customers on strategic planning, service expectations, and training, including establishing QBR/FBR processes.
     

  • Ensure consistent communication to enhance customer satisfaction and keep clients informed about relevant industry trends.
     

  • Identify and engage additional decision-makers using SFDC and research tools.
     

  • Support the sales team with proposals, SOWs, pricing models, and account planning.
     

Business Opportunity Development:

  • Focus on low-share-of-wallet accounts to unlock new growth opportunities.
     

  • Evaluate customer needs and match them with relevant Iron Mountain solutions.
     

  • Develop strategies and business plans based on a thorough understanding of client business models and value propositions.
     

  • Help position Iron Mountain’s value proposition effectively, working with the sales team to promote total solution offerings.
     

  • Assist in preparing for contract negotiations and renewal processes.
     

  • Stay informed on competitive dynamics impacting assigned accounts.
     

Contract Renewals & Negotiations:

  • Collaborate with BDEs to manage contract renewals and RFPs by identifying service gaps and customer requirements.
     

  • Participate in pricing and SLA discussions to support retention strategies.
     

  • Analyze customer service usage and propose pricing or structural changes where appropriate.
     

  • Identify at-risk accounts and work with internal teams to develop strategies for retention.
     

Customer Experience & Escalations:

  • Investigate and resolve escalated service or billing issues by coordinating with appropriate internal teams.
     

  • Partner with internal stakeholders (e.g., Sales Support, Customer Care, Field Operations) to fulfill ad-hoc customer requests such as audits, reports, or site visits.
     

  • Lead initiatives to retain at-risk accounts by identifying pain points and recommending effective solutions.
     

  • Ensure all customer interactions and actions comply with applicable laws, regulations, and company policies.
     

  • Stay informed about industry trends, compliance requirements, and Iron Mountain’s evolving service offerings.
     

  • Work closely with Market, Area, and Corporate teams to ensure alignment on customer strategy and execution.
     

  • Collaborate with Collections and other critical functions to resolve outstanding issues impacting customer satisfaction.

Qualifications:
  • Strong business acumen with a comprehensive understanding of Iron Mountain’s services and competitive landscape.
     

  • Proven ability to manage complex client relationships and support cross-functional teams.
     

  • Experience in service delivery, customer success, account management, or consultative sales is preferred.
     

  • Familiarity with CRM tools like Salesforce (SFDC) and standard business productivity tools.
     

  • Excellent communication, negotiation, and problem-solving skills.
     

Category: Sales Operations Group

Top Skills

Business Productivity Tools
Salesforce
SFDC

Similar Jobs

2 Days Ago
In-Office
Gurugram, Haryana, IND
Mid level
Mid level
Security
The Senior Executive - Customer Support will manage customer inquiries, promote service growth, build client relationships, and ensure exceptional service delivery.
Top Skills: Erp SystemsMS Office
7 Hours Ago
In-Office
New Delhi, Delhi, IND
Mid level
Mid level
Food • Retail • Agriculture • Manufacturing
The Business Development Executive focuses on achieving sales targets, managing distribution, and building relationships with distributors and sales teams.
7 Hours Ago
Hybrid
Bangalore, Bengaluru, Karnataka, IND
Entry level
Entry level
Cloud • Computer Vision • Information Technology • Sales • Security • Cybersecurity
Maximize opportunities by engaging with prospective customers over the phone, conducting discovery calls, and collaborating on sales strategies in cybersecurity.
Top Skills: CybersecuritySaaS

What you need to know about the Pune Tech Scene

Once a far-out concept, AI is now a tangible force reshaping industries and economies worldwide. While its adoption will automate some roles, AI has created more jobs than it has displaced, with an expected 97 million new roles to be created in the coming years. This is especially true in cities like Pune, which is emerging as a hub for companies eager to leverage this technology to develop solutions that simplify and improve lives in sectors such as education, healthcare, finance, e-commerce and more.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account